Shocking: Rajjat Barjatya dies of cancer

This has come as shocker.

Mammoth loss for Indian media and entertainment industry as an asset of Barjatya family Rajjat A Barjatya breathed his last at a young age of 41.

Rajjat, son of Ajit Kumar Barjatya lost his battle to cancer today evening.

The production master class who has not only contributed immensely on TV and films but has also played a pivotal role in taking Indian content to the global map through internet.

Rajjat was the MD and CEO of Rajshri Entertainment and the Founder and Managing Trustee at Rajshri Foundation. He was also actively involved in his family’s reputed business, the Rajshri Productions studio that has produced iconic films like Maine Pyar Kiya, Hum Apke Hai Koun and more recently Prem Ratan Dhan Payo.

Rajat, who was informed about his leukemia in 2010, battled the tough disease for six months. But sadly he was diagnosed with a relapse three months back. The family has been trying to get a bone marrow transplant done, but seems time and fate was not on their side. Rajjat passed away today (29 July) evening at 6: 30 pm at Jaslok Hospital.

Rajjat is survived by his wife Neha and two daugters.

May his soul rest in peace.

As per latest information, Rajjat will be cremated tomorrow (30 July) at Worli crematorium, 1 p.m.
